![]() The mid-mounted twin-turbo 3.8-liter V8 engine paired with its high-performance electric motor generate a mind-boggling 986hp. With no regulations to limit them, the engineers at McLaren were let loose to turn everything to 11 with every intent of maxing performance out of every possible system. The results are a staggering set of numbers: A combined output of 986 horsepower, 0-60 miles per hour in just 2.4 seconds and will reach a top speed of 225 miles an hour, all while being able to brake from 60 miles an hour to 0 in 85 feet while cornering at 1.54Gs. 110 pounds are stripped from the already-lightweight body by removing various components including sound deadening materials and replacing the car’s glass with polycarbonate. the normal P1 ensures space for wider front and rear tires for ample grip. Together these touches produce a whole new package, creating this ultimate hardcore P1. The GTR was given revised engine mapping for a power boost, a fixed and larger hydraulically-actuated wing that was capable of immense downforce, special aerodynamic improvements including a larger front splitter and carbon fiber underside which is good for 10% more downforce. However, due to the similarities to the road car, there have been a number of cars made to allow the P1 GTR to become road-legal. The McLaren P1 GTR was originally released as a special track-only version of McLaren’s P1 street car, available and offered to only to McLaren P1 owners once the last of the 375 street P1s were completed. The most hardcore, race-oriented and limited-edition McLaren P1 ever created. McLaren took ahold of those reins and then some with this: the 2016 McLaren P1 GTR.
